Official details
Full official description
Visitor facilities: Toilets Flush toilets Picnic tables Barbecue facilities Gas/electric barbecues (free) Boat ramp Carpark Drinking water Step-free access The picnic area is mostly flat and step-free, but there are no pathways. You'll need to cross over flat grass, the asphalt carpark and the road to reach the facilities. Seats and resting points There are many bench seats around the picnic area, including near the river and near the carpark. | Permitted: Fishing A current NSW recreational fishing licence is required when fishing in all waters. Please note that spear guns and hand spears are not permitted in Ku-ring-gai Chase National Park. They may not be carried through the park and must not be used within 100m of a beach in the national park. | Prohibited: Camp fires and solid fuel burners Open fires and any form of solid fuel are not allowed. Gathering firewood Pets Pets and domestic animals (other than certified assistance animals) are not permitted. Find out which regional parks allow dog walking and see the pets in parks policy for more information. Smoking NSW national parks are no smoking areas .
